Apa itu Mode Debugging USB di Android? Cara Mengaktifkannya

Apa itu Mode Debugging USB di Android? Cara Mengaktifkannya

Android mudah digunakan di luar kotak, tetapi memiliki banyak fitur tersembunyi untuk pengguna yang kuat. Secara khusus, Anda mungkin tahu tentang yang tersembunyi Opsi Pengembang Tidak bisa. Sesuai dengan namanya, fitur-fitur ini berguna untuk pengembang yang membuat aplikasi Android, tetapi tidak begitu penting bagi rata-rata pengguna.





Salah satu fitur pengembang Android yang paling terkenal adalah USB Debugging . Anda mungkin pernah melihat istilah ini beredar dan bertanya-tanya apakah Anda harus mengaktifkannya. Mari kita lihat untuk apa mode Debugging USB Android dan jika Anda membutuhkannya.





Apa itu Mode Debugging USB di Android?

USB Debugging memungkinkan perangkat Android untuk berkomunikasi dengan komputer yang menjalankan Android SDK untuk menggunakan operasi lanjutan.





Saat Anda mengembangkan aplikasi Android, Anda harus menginstal Android Software Developer Kit (SDK) di komputer Anda. SDK memberi pengembang alat yang mereka butuhkan untuk membuat aplikasi untuk platform tertentu.

Biasanya, Anda menginstal ini bersama Android Studio , yang merupakan lingkungan pengembangan untuk aplikasi Android. Ini mencakup seperangkat alat yang penting bagi pengembang mana pun, seperti debugger untuk memperbaiki masalah dan editor visual.



Perpustakaan adalah komponen kunci lain dari SDK. Ini memungkinkan pengembang untuk melakukan fungsi umum tanpa harus mengkode ulang. Misalnya, Android memiliki fungsi pencetakan bawaan, jadi saat menulis aplikasi, Anda tidak perlu memikirkan cara baru untuk mencetak. Anda cukup memanggil metode built-in yang disertakan dalam perpustakaan ketika saatnya untuk melakukannya.

Anda dapat melakukan banyak hal dengan Android dari perangkat itu sendiri. Tetapi pengembang membutuhkan lebih banyak opsi. Akan sangat merepotkan untuk memindahkan file secara manual antar perangkat, menjalankan perintah, dan melakukan tugas serupa. Sebagai gantinya, mereka menggunakan alat yang ada di dalam Android Studio dan Android SDK untuk merampingkan proses ini. Dan Anda harus mengaktifkan USB debugging untuk melakukannya.





cara memutar musik dari ponsel ke tv dengan usb

Jika Anda tidak membutuhkan keseluruhan Android Studio, Anda dapat menginstal Android SDK saja. Anda harus melakukan ini untuk banyak metode rooting umum, serta melakukan tugas-tugas lanjutan lainnya.

Mengaktifkan USB Debugging memungkinkan ponsel Anda untuk sepenuhnya berkomunikasi dengan PC sehingga Anda dapat memanfaatkan alat ini. Tidak perlu mengaktifkan USB debugging jika Anda hanya ingin sambungkan ponsel dan PC Anda dengan Bluetooth atau kabel USB untuk tugas-tugas sederhana seperti menyinkronkan foto.





Bagaimana Cara Mengaktifkan USB Debugging di Android?

Pada perangkat Android modern, Anda akan menemukan USB Debugging di Opsi Pengembang menu, yang disembunyikan secara default.

Untuk membukanya, buka Pengaturan dan gulir ke bawah ke Tentang telepon . Gulir ke bawah lagi pada menu berikutnya, dan Anda akan melihat Nomor pembuatan masuk di bagian bawah. Ketuk ini beberapa kali, dan Anda akhirnya akan melihat pemberitahuan yang memberi tahu Anda bahwa Anda sekarang adalah seorang pengembang.

Selanjutnya, lompat kembali ke Pengaturan dan gulir ke bawah ke bawah lagi. Buka Sistem masuk dan kembangkan Canggih bagian. Di sini Anda akan melihat entri baru berjudul Opsi pengembang .

Galeri Gambar (3 Gambar) Mengembangkan Mengembangkan Mengembangkan Menutup

Tergantung pada versi Android Anda, langkah-langkah ini dapat sedikit berbeda. Anda mungkin melihat Opsi pengembang entri terdaftar di utama Pengaturan halaman sebagai gantinya, misalnya.

Bagaimanapun, begitu Anda berada di dalam Opsi pengembang menu, cari USB debugging di bawah Debug kepala. Tekan penggeser untuk mengaktifkannya, dan konfirmasikan peringatan Android bahwa Anda memahami untuk apa fitur ini.

Galeri Gambar (2 Gambar) Mengembangkan Mengembangkan Menutup

Sekarang Anda telah mengaktifkan USB Debugging. Untuk menggunakannya, Anda hanya perlu mencolokkan ponsel ke PC menggunakan kabel USB. Ketika Anda melakukan ini, Anda akan melihat prompt di telepon Anda menanyakan apakah Anda ingin mengotorisasi USB Debugging untuk komputer tertentu.

Ini adalah fitur keamanan yang dirancang untuk menjaga perangkat Anda aman dari serangan, jadi pastikan Anda memercayai komputer sebelum menerima ini. Jika Anda pernah menerima prompt untuk perangkat secara tidak sengaja, pilih Cabut otorisasi debugging USB dari halaman opsi Pengembang yang sama untuk mengatur ulang semua komputer tepercaya.

Apa yang Dilakukan Android USB Debugging?

Tanpa USB Debugging, Anda tidak dapat mengirim perintah lanjutan apa pun ke ponsel Anda melalui kabel USB. Dengan demikian, pengembang perlu mengaktifkan debugging USB sehingga mereka dapat mendorong aplikasi ke perangkat mereka untuk diuji dan berinteraksi.

Saat Anda membuat versi baru aplikasi di Android Studio dan ingin mengujinya, Anda dapat mendorongnya ke perangkat yang terhubung hanya dengan beberapa klik. Setelah membangun, itu akan langsung berjalan dan muncul di perangkat Anda. Ini jauh lebih cepat dari sideloading file APK secara manual setiap saat.

Alasan umum bagi non-pengembang untuk mengaktifkan debugging USB adalah untuk melakukan root pada ponsel mereka. Rooting bervariasi menurut perangkat dan berubah dari waktu ke waktu, tetapi sebagian besar metode melibatkan beberapa program yang Anda jalankan dari desktop Anda. Setelah Anda mengaktifkan USB debugging dan menghubungkan ponsel Anda, Anda dapat menggunakan alat untuk mengirim instruksi root ke perangkat Anda bahkan tanpa menyentuhnya. Menginstal ROM kustom melibatkan proses serupa.

Anda juga perlu mengaktifkan USB Debugging untuk menggunakan perintah Android Debug Bridge (ADB). Dengan menggunakan ini, Anda dapat menginstal file APK yang tersimpan di PC ke ponsel Anda, memindahkan file bolak-balik, dan melihat log perangkat untuk kesalahan debugging. Perintah ADB dan Fastboot juga dapat menyimpan perangkat bata Anda bahkan ketika Anda tidak dapat menyalakannya secara normal.

Di masa lalu Android, Anda juga membutuhkan USB Debugging untuk beberapa fungsi lainnya. Yang paling menonjol adalah mengambil tangkapan layar melalui USB, yang sama menyebalkannya dengan kedengarannya. Ini sebelumnya mengambil tangkapan layar di Android memiliki perintah standar dan mudah.

xbox yang mana yang harus saya beli?

Sekarang, Anda hanya perlu menahan kombinasi tombol perangkat Anda (biasanya Kekuasaan dan Volume Turun ) untuk mengambil tangkapan layar, menjadikan metode ini usang.

Apakah USB Debugging Aman?

Secara teori, dengan USB Debugging diaktifkan, mencolokkan ponsel Anda ke port pengisian daya publik dapat membuka risiko. Jika seseorang memiliki akses ke port tersebut, mereka berpotensi mencuri informasi dari perangkat Anda atau mendorong aplikasi berbahaya ke dalamnya.

Inilah sebabnya mengapa Android menampilkan prompt konfirmasi, sehingga Anda tidak terhubung ke PC yang tidak Anda percayai. Namun, pengguna yang tidak curiga dapat menerima prompt tanpa menyadari untuk apa itu.

Selain itu, membiarkan USB Debugging diaktifkan membuat perangkat Anda terbuka untuk diserang jika Anda kehilangannya. Seseorang yang mengetahui apa yang mereka lakukan dapat menghubungkan perangkat Anda ke komputer mereka dan mengeluarkan perintah melalui ADB, tanpa mengetahui PIN Anda atau keamanan layar kunci lainnya.

Itu menakutkan, dan alasan bagus Anda harus menyiapkan Pengelola Perangkat Android agar Anda bisa setel ulang pabrik perangkat Android Anda dari jarak jauh.

Kecuali Anda secara teratur menggunakan ADB dan menghubungkan perangkat Android Anda ke PC, Anda tidak boleh membiarkan USB Debugging diaktifkan sepanjang waktu. Tidak apa-apa untuk membiarkannya selama beberapa hari saat Anda sedang mengerjakan sesuatu, tetapi tidak perlu mengaktifkannya saat Anda tidak menggunakannya secara teratur. Risikonya lebih besar daripada manfaatnya dalam kasus itu.

Jika USB Debugging Tidak Berfungsi

Jika Anda telah mengaktifkan USB debugging dan tidak berfungsi, kemungkinan besar kabel USB Anda atau beberapa opsi konfigurasi yang harus disalahkan. Lihat apa yang harus dilakukan ketika ponsel Android Anda tidak dapat terhubung ke komputer Anda untuk memperbaiki masalah Anda.

Pastikan Anda juga telah menginstal dan memperbarui Android SDK di komputer dengan benar.

Apakah Node Tree Debugging Sama dengan USB Debugging?

Selain USB Debugging, Android menawarkan opsi bernama sama yang disebut Node Tree Debugging. Ini terkubur jauh di dalam menu terpisah sehingga Anda tidak mungkin menemukannya secara alami, tetapi masih berguna untuk mengetahui perbedaannya.

Node Tree Debugging adalah opsi pengembang di dalam TalkBack, yang merupakan pembaca layar Android. Alat ini memungkinkan ponsel Anda membaca konten layar dengan keras, membantu pengguna dengan disabilitas visual untuk bernavigasi di sekitar perangkat mereka.

cara mengetahui siapa yang memblokir Anda di facebook

Dibawah Setelan > Aksesibilitas > TalkBack > Setelan > Setelan lanjutan > Setelan pengembang , Anda akan melihat opsi yang disebut Aktifkan debugging pohon simpul . Ini mengirimkan informasi tentang isi layar Anda ke log perangkat Anda.

Tujuan dari fitur ini adalah untuk membantu pengembang mendesain aplikasi mereka untuk aksesibilitas, dan mengetahui apa sebenarnya yang dilaporkan TalkBack kepada pengguna adalah penting untuk hal ini.

Galeri Gambar (3 Gambar) Mengembangkan Mengembangkan Mengembangkan Menutup

Jika Anda bukan seorang pengembang, Node Tree Debugging tidak ada gunanya. Anda tidak perlu khawatir untuk menyalakannya.

Bagaimana Anda Menggunakan Android USB Debugging?

Kami telah mengikuti tur tentang apa yang dilakukan USB Debugging dan untuk apa Anda dapat menggunakannya. Singkatnya, fitur ini memungkinkan Anda untuk mendorong perintah lanjutan ke perangkat Anda saat Anda menghubungkan ponsel ke PC.

USB Debugging sangat penting untuk pengembang, tetapi juga membuka beberapa trik yang berguna untuk pengguna listrik. Meskipun Anda merasa bebas untuk mengaktifkannya saat dibutuhkan, kami sarankan untuk tetap mematikannya saat Anda tidak menggunakannya. Ini akan meningkatkan keamanan perangkat Anda.

Sementara itu, USB Debugging hanyalah salah satu fitur praktis yang tersedia di menu opsi Pengembang.

Kredit Gambar: caluian.daniel/ foto deposit

Membagikan Membagikan Menciak Surel 15 Opsi Pengembang Android Terbaik yang Layak Diperbaiki

Berikut adalah opsi pengembang terbaik di Android: nonaktifkan volume absolut, paksa kecepatan refresh lebih cepat, dan banyak lagi!

Baca Selanjutnya
Topik-topik yang berkaitan
  • Teknologi Dijelaskan
  • Android
  • Rooting Android
  • Pengembangan Aplikasi
  • Kustomisasi Android
  • Android Tips
Tentang Penulis Ben Stegner(1735 Artikel Diterbitkan)

Ben adalah Wakil Editor dan Manajer Orientasi di MakeUseOf. Dia meninggalkan pekerjaan IT-nya untuk menulis penuh waktu pada tahun 2016 dan tidak pernah menoleh ke belakang. Dia telah meliput tutorial teknologi, rekomendasi video game, dan lebih banyak lagi sebagai penulis profesional selama lebih dari tujuh tahun.

More From Ben Stegner

Berlangganan newsletter kami

Bergabunglah dengan buletin kami untuk kiat teknologi, ulasan, ebook gratis, dan penawaran eksklusif!

Klik di sini untuk berlangganan